GEEZER BUTLER Actually Would not Like BLACK SABBATH’s By no means Say Die!

Black Sabbath‘s 1978 report By no means Say Die! was the band’s remaining album to function vocalist Ozzy Osbourne till their farewell effort 13 in 2013. Osbourne even give up Black Sabbath throughout the rcording periods, and was briefly changed by Fleetwood Mac vocalist Dave Walker till his return (which is a complete separate story). Exterior Osbourne, Black Sabbath was struggling exhausting with alcohol and drug abuse, and the lineup simply wasn’t getting alongside.

So it is no shock that in an interview with Metal Edge Magazine, bassist Geezer Butler known as By no means Say Die! “simply the worst album we did.” Butler mentioned the band misplaced the plot on By no means Say Die!, although looking back he believes that Osbourne‘s strategy was the proper one.

“These have been actually an issue, too. The factor is, we have been making an attempt to progress an excessive amount of musically. We fully misplaced the plot, I feel. We stopped doing the issues that made Sabbath what it was and commenced going from extra melodic stuff, which was a mistake trying again. Ozzy at all times needed to nonetheless sound just like the previous model of Sabbath, whereas Tony and I needed to broaden musically. Wanting again, Ozzy was most likely proper as a result of our enlargement brought on us to lose what Sabbath was alleged to be about.

He continued: “Undoubtedly not in the identical method I view the sooner information. And I’ll say that By no means Say Die! is well the worst album we did. The rationale for that’s we tried to handle ourselves and produce the report ourselves. We needed to do it on our personal, however in reality, not one among us had a single clue about what to do. By that time, we have been spending extra time with legal professionals and in courtroom quite than being within the studio writing. It was simply an excessive amount of strain on us, and the writing suffered.”
